On Tuesday, June 21, 2022, gold was priced at C$76,571.45 per kilogram in Canadian Dollars, based on a CAD spot price of C$2,381.64 per troy ounce. One troy ounce equals 0.0311035 kilograms. The daily trading range was C$76,383.69 to C$76,738.31 per kg, a spread of C$354.62.
Compared to the previous trading session, gold per kilogram rose by C$123.46 (+0.16%). Kilogram gold bars are a popular choice among Canadian institutional investors, pension funds, and those looking to make larger bullion purchases. The Royal Canadian Mint offers kilo bars in 99.99% purity, which are LBMA-approved and recognized worldwide.
In 2022, gold in CAD traded between C$2,187.41 and C$2,611.61, with an annual average of C$2,340.30. This day's price was 1.8% above the yearly average and -8.8% from the year's high.
